Description
Whether it be trying radical new processes, celebrating local produce in our culinary-inspired beers, or attempting perfection through more traditional styles, we are always challenging ourselves and pushing for creating amazing moments, flavors, textures, and stories. We enjoying challenging the status quo and doing the unexpected. And making really, really bad jokes.
